About The Position

This position follows a hybrid schedule with one onsite day per week on Thursdays. Additional onsite days may be required periodically to support meetings, project work, or evolving team and business needs. Are you passionate about ensuring pharmacy benefits are accurate, compliant, and working seamlessly behind the scenes? As a Pharmacy Specialist – primary focus on Part B and Part D determinations, Hospice, and ESRD - you’ll play a critical role in supporting pharmacy operations by partnering closely with the Pharmacy Benefit Managers (PBM), vendors, and internal teams to ensure benefit designs and systems are configured and administered correctly. This role is ideal for someone who thrives at the intersection of pharmacy operations, data integrity, and regulatory compliance—and who enjoys solving complex issues to support members, employer groups, and internal stakeholders alike.

Responsibilities

  • Assists in developing and maintaining of the pharmacy operations systems.
  • Direct interaction with Pharmacy Benefit Manager and other pharmacy vendors to ensure all systems and pharmacy benefits are administered accurately.
  • Assist external and internal customers with pharmacy benefit and administration questions and issue resolution.
  • Ensures governmental compliance by monitoring and auditing various vendors and processes.
  • Monitors extract exchanges with vendors and escalates concerns.
  • Work with internal teams to create benefit grids and custom plan requests for system set up, and tests to ensure accurate configuration with the PBM.
  • Implements, audits and validates drug formulary changes and processes submissions to regulatory bodies.
  • Coordinates member communication with Marketing.
  • Reporting and analyzing data to ensure accuracy and compliance.
  • Participates and reports on behalf of the company in a variety of audits from governing bodies.
  • Oversees PBM, vendors, and internal processes to ensure compliance.
  • Communicates effectively with internal and external customers, avoiding jargon to ensure understanding.
  • Participates in projects to represent Pharmacy Operations.
